- As U.S. Border Czar Tom Homan announced on Feb. 12 plans for federal agents to leave the Twin Cities metro area, Catholic leaders in the Archdiocese of St. Paul and Minneapolis acknowledged the need for hope as they look to next steps in the local community.
- All Catholics are called to stand together by reaching out to their brothers and sisters in the faith of all ethnicities, especially those of Hispanic heritage, Archbishop Alexander K. Sample of Portland, Oregon, said.
- Catholic theologians and environmentalists are concerned after President Donald Trump announced Feb. 12 the administration will repeal a landmark scientific finding that was the legal basis for federal greenhouse-gas regulation.
- Gunmen in Nigeria's Kaduna state abducted 32 people, including a Catholic catechist and his pregnant wife, in the latest attack targeting Christian communities.
- Leaders of four major European bishops' conferences are urging renewed unity, warning that global instability and rising nationalism threaten both Europe and the wider world.
